DISPLAY BLOCK (DISP)

The display block is used to assign display resources and keyboard actions to one user
display. Display resources are identified as shown below. Keyboard actions include pressing,
holding and releasing one of the eight available keys (Alarm through the down arrow -

). In

its simplest form, the display block connects variable data for presentation as values on lines
or bars. These values can be formatted and identified with engineering units or other labels.
More advanced functions are accomplished using the display script language. A display
script is an event driven set of statements used to respond to keyboard actions and other
events. The state of the Display block is defined within the script (there can be multiple
states) and uses the State Table block and the Tune List block for valid state lists and tune
lists. Multiple display blocks can be configured for an instrument and each requires that it be
listed in the Display Interface block to be accessible. Display blocks are only executed when
the instrument is in RUN. In all other states, only the device displays will be available.
